Question: If a state minimum wage law provides greater protection than the federal minimum wage, do I still have to post the federal Fair Labor Standards Act/Minimum Wage poster?
Answer: Yes. If a state law provides greater protection (e.g., has a higher minimum wage than the federal minimum wage), the employer still has to post the federal Fair Labor Standards Act (FLSA) / Minimum Wage poster. (Note that the federal poster provides information regarding federal regulations on child labor and overtime rules in addition to the federal minimum wage.)
